Framed by over 25,000 km of intricate coastline, Norway’s identity is inseparable from its waters. The country’s maritime landscape—marked by deep fjords, sheltered bays, and remote islands—has evolved over centuries of seafaring, trade, and fishing. Modern marinas, predictable summer conditions, and short cruising legs make Norway one of Europe’s most adaptable yacht-charter destinations, ideal for travellers seeking effortless transitions between nature, culture, and open water.

Norway’s yachting conditions are most favorable in summer, though Arctic cruises require careful planning. Peak season coincides with long daylight hours, calm fjord waters, and predictable summer winds.
Chartering in Norway begins with selecting the right region and yacht for your journey—motor yachts for fjord speed and comfort, catamarans for shallow bays, or expedition vessels for Arctic waters.
